PG电子试玩教程,从入门到精通pg电子试玩教程

PG电子试玩教程,从入门到精通pg电子试玩教程,

本文目录导读:

  1. PG电子的基本概念
  2. PG电子的安装与配置
  3. 游戏开发流程
  4. PG电子试玩体验
  5. 总结与展望

PG电子(Playable Game Engine)是现代游戏开发中非常重要的工具之一,它提供了一个开放的平台,允许开发者使用多种编程语言(如C++、C#、Python)快速开发高质量的游戏,本文将详细介绍PG电子的基本概念、安装与配置、游戏开发流程以及试玩体验,帮助你全面掌握PG电子的使用方法。

PG电子的基本概念

PG电子(Playable Game Engine)是一个基于OpenGL和DirectX的多平台游戏引擎,支持Windows、Mac、Linux等操作系统,它提供了一个高度可定制的框架,允许开发者轻松构建各种类型的游戏,包括2D和3D游戏、桌面游戏、移动游戏等。

PG电子的核心优势在于其高度可定制性,开发者可以根据需求自定义API(应用程序编程接口),并使用多种插件和扩展来增强功能,PG电子还支持跨平台开发,这意味着你可以在一个项目中同时为Windows、Mac和Linux平台生成代码,极大提高了开发效率。

PG电子的安装与配置

Windows平台

安装步骤:

  1. 下载PG电子:从官方网站下载适合Windows的安装包。
  2. 安装依赖项:PG电子需要一些编译器和构建工具,如Visual Studio、Git等,安装这些依赖项后,打开PG电子的安装程序。
  3. 选择构建选项:根据你的需求选择构建选项,如选择C++或C#作为主要语言,选择目标平台(如Windows Game)等。
  4. 开始构建:完成配置后,点击“开始构建”按钮,PG电子将开始构建你的游戏项目。

配置说明:

  • 编译器选择:根据你的开发语言选择合适的编译器。
  • 构建选项:设置构建时的优化级别、目标平台等参数。
  • 环境变量:设置必要的环境变量,如PG_Engine\bin\PGConfig\PGDevConfig\PGDevConfig.sys文件中的内容。

Mac平台

安装步骤:

  1. 下载PG电子:从官方网站下载适用于Mac的安装包。
  2. 安装依赖项:PG电子需要一些编译器和构建工具,如Xcode、Git等,安装这些依赖项后,打开PG电子的安装程序。
  3. 配置项目:根据你的需求配置项目,如选择C++作为主要语言,选择目标平台(如macOS Game)等。
  4. 开始构建:完成配置后,点击“开始构建”按钮,PG电子将开始构建你的游戏项目。

配置说明:

  • 编译器选择:根据你的开发语言选择合适的编译器。
  • 构建选项:设置构建时的优化级别、目标平台等参数。
  • 环境变量:设置必要的环境变量,如PG_Engine\bin\PGConfig\PGDevConfig\PGDevConfig macOS文件中的内容。

Linux平台

安装步骤:

  1. 下载PG电子:从官方网站下载适用于Linux的安装包。
  2. 安装依赖项:PG电子需要一些编译器和构建工具,如G++, Git等,安装这些依赖项后,打开PG电子的安装程序。
  3. 配置项目:根据你的需求配置项目,如选择C++作为主要语言,选择目标平台(如Linux Game)等。
  4. 开始构建:完成配置后,点击“开始构建”按钮,PG电子将开始构建你的游戏项目。

配置说明:

  • 编译器选择:根据你的开发语言选择合适的编译器。
  • 构建选项:设置构建时的优化级别、目标平台等参数。
  • 环境变量:设置必要的环境变量,如PG_Engine\bin\PGConfig\PGDevConfig\PGDevConfig_linux文件中的内容。

游戏开发流程

项目创建

在PG电子中,首先需要创建一个新的项目,打开PG电子的项目创建界面,选择目标平台(如Windows Game、macOS Game、Linux Game等),然后输入项目名称和路径,PG电子会根据你的选择自动下载并安装必要的开发工具和依赖项。

编写代码

PG电子支持多种编程语言,包括C++、C#和Python,你可以根据自己的需求选择使用哪种语言,编写代码时,可以利用PG电子提供的API来简化开发过程。

编译与构建

编写完代码后,需要进行编译与构建,PG电子会自动检测代码中的错误并提示你进行修复,编译完成后,PG电子会生成可执行文件,你可以通过运行可执行文件来测试游戏。

游戏调试

在游戏开发过程中,调试是非常重要的一环,PG电子提供了多种调试工具,如图形调试器、性能分析工具等,帮助你快速定位和解决问题。

游戏发布

完成游戏开发后,需要进行游戏发布,PG电子支持多种发布方式,如直接发布到PC平台、发布到云服务(如AWS、Azure等)等,发布后,玩家可以通过相应的平台下载游戏。

PG电子试玩体验

设置试玩环境

在试玩游戏之前,需要设置一个良好的试玩环境,这包括配置游戏的分辨率、帧率、音量等参数,PG电子提供了试玩配置工具,帮助你轻松设置试玩环境。

游戏体验测试

试玩过程中,你可以通过PG电子提供的分析工具来测试游戏的性能、稳定性等,PG电子的试玩工具可以自动记录游戏的运行时间、内存使用情况、图形渲染情况等数据。

问题修复与优化

在试玩过程中,你可能会遇到各种问题,如游戏卡顿、加载缓慢等,PG电子提供的调试工具可以帮助你快速定位和解决问题,通过PG电子的性能分析工具,你可以优化游戏的性能,提升游戏的整体体验。

分享与推广

试玩结束后,你可以将游戏分享到社交媒体、游戏论坛等平台,吸引更多玩家关注,PG电子还支持游戏的推广,如添加游戏截图、视频、说明等信息,帮助游戏吸引更多潜在玩家。

总结与展望

PG电子作为现代游戏开发的重要工具,为开发者提供了一个高度可定制的框架,极大提升了游戏开发的效率,通过本文的详细介绍,你已经掌握了PG电子的基本概念、安装与配置、游戏开发流程以及试玩体验,PG电子将继续发展,支持更多平台和功能,为游戏开发提供更多可能性,希望本文能帮助你更好地理解和使用PG电子,让你的游戏开发之路更加顺利。

PG电子试玩教程,从入门到精通pg电子试玩教程,

发表评论